House of Musical Traditions in Takoma Park, MD (just outside of Washington DC) is a dealer for Bob Gramann acoustic guitars. Here we have Mark Sylvester, one of our teachers, demonstrating the #27 Maury model guitar. It features an Englemann Spruce top, Honduran Rosewood back & sides, Macassar Ebony fingerboard, East Indian Rosewood bridge & trim, and a Mahogany neck. The Maury is the size of a Martin Dreadnought except the waist is pulled in to make the notes sound more clearly. The guitar has a rich, bright tone & a fast neck.

Bob Gramann builds guitars in Fredericksburg, VA. He delights in the results of careful thinning, bending, and finishing of fine woods. Most important is achieving such a rich, full sound that it is loud enough for performances without amplification. Amazingly, even tiny adjustments can enhance both tone and volume, producing a responsive instrument that feels good to play. Building these "live" guitars has become almost an obsession. He builds only a few instruments each year, so he always tries to build something he would want to play.
